Safety Policy
We accept and support
all matters pertaining to safety in each place of work. this includes
our employees and extends to everyone else within our immediate
work site vicinity.
The objectives of our
Safety Policy are:
- To achieve achieve full compliance
to OHS legislation, in particular the 2000 Act and the 2001 Regulation.
- To involve all employees in the
principle of The Duty of Care requirement.
- To affirm all employees are correctly
inducted, trained and supervised to ensure their health, safety
and welfare.
- To ensure all other people are not
exposed to any risks to their health or safety, arising from the
nature of our work undertaken at a work site.
- To certify all systems of work are
safe and all jobs have Safe Work Method Statements prepared.
- To provide equipment that is safe
and properly maintained in conjunction with the appropriate safety
equipment for each site.
We remain committed to promoting open
communication between all parties involved with safety issues in
the work place.
